127 Road Accidents Reported in Assam on Diwali

Amidst the Diwali celebrations in the state, 127road accidents took place, according to the data provided by Mrityunjay 108.

These 127 numbers of accidents attended by Mrityunjay during the festive season of Diwali. According to the data, Kamrup (M) and Kamrup topped the list with 16 cases each followed by Dhemaji (13), Barpeta (10), Sonitpur (8), Lakhimpur, Nalbari and Golaghat recorded with seven accidents each while Jorhat, Sivasagar, Dhubri and Baksa have five cases each. Dibrugarh and Nagaon recorded with four accidents while Bongaigaon and Goalpara have three cases each. Udalguri, Cachar and Chirang district recorded with two accidents each while Kokrajhar, Darrang, and Tinsukia have one case each.

On the other hand, Mrityunjay 108 received 17 number of bun cases on the auspicious festival and Udalguri topped the list with six burn cases followed by Kamrup (M) with three, Kamrup, Jorhat, and Dibrugarh with two cases each and Lakhimpur and Sonitpur with one case each.

These are only the cases that are attended by Mrityunjay 108. This reveals that more than 150 cases of accidents occurred in the festive season of Diwali in the state.
